A late Kai Havertz penalty ensured Arsenal avoided defeat for first time in the Champions League this season against Bayer Leverkusen on Wednesday. The Gunners arrived in Leverkusen for their last-16 first leg having won all eight games in the league phase to top the group and earn, arguably, a favourable path in the knockout phase draw.
However, there will be work for Arsenal to do in next week’s second leg at the Emirates Stadium as they must win in north London to ensure progression to the quarter-final against either Bodo/Glimt or Sporting CP. Leverkusen captain Robert Andrich scored the first goal of the last-16 tie a minute into the second half, peeling away at the back post to head home a corner.
Though with time running out Havertz cooly dispatched his penalty, against his former club, after Noni Madueke had been fouled to ensure the Gunners remain unbeaten in this season’s competition - even if their perfect record has come to an end. Last time out
17:20 , Tashan Deniran-AlleyneIt is over 20 years since Arsenal last faced Bayer Leverkusen in a competitive fixture.
Those meetings were such a long time ago that the Champions League ran under a different format with two group stages.
After a 1-1 draw in Germany, the Gunners beat a Leverkusen side that contained the likes of Michael Ballack, Lucio and Dimitar Berbatov 4-1 at Highbury with Dennis Bergkamp scoring the pick of the goals.

Arsenal team news
15:25 , Tashan Deniran-AlleyneWilliam Saliba has been passed fit to face Bayer Leverkusen on Wednesday, but Arsenal captain Martin Odegaard has been ruled out.
The centre-back missed the wins over Brighton and Mansfield with an ankle injury that was not related to the similar issue he was hampered with earlier in the season.
However, Saliba trained with the Arsenal squad on Tuesday morning and he is expected to make his return in Germany.
There remain question marks over the fitness of both Riccardo Calafiori and Leandro Trossard, who were forced off with injuries in the FA Cup win on Saturday.
The pair did train before the squad flew out to Leverkusen, but Mikel Arteta was typically coy when asked about their availability at his pre-match press conference.
